This is one complex tile. If you only have 2GB of RAM I recommend tuning down the MaxComplexity setting on your machine. Given that the tileset that failed has a size of File size: 12.4 MB I recomment setting it to something around 10000000 (and lower if you still see freezes). This will refuse tilesets that have a bgger byte size than the setting. There is a patch to implement auto-tuning of the maxcomplexity setting, but that hasn't been incorporated yet. spaetz _______________________________________________ Tilesathome mailing list [email protected] http://lists.openstreetmap.org/listinfo/tilesathome
